Encrypt.me Delivers Frictionless Security and Privacy Services for Its On-the-Go Users with NS1’s Next Generation DNS

Encrypt.me, a mobile and desktop security service that automatically protects users on untrusted networks, faced a scaling challenge as its frictionless “auto-secure” experience drove rapid growth. Active connections and infrastructure footprint grew 300% in a year, exposing performance and scale limits in its DNS: users were sometimes routed hundreds of miles away (causing up to a 60% performance hit) and engineers spent hours on manual, hard-coded changes that weren’t sustainable.

Encrypt.me migrated from Amazon Route 53 to NS1’s next-generation DNS, adopting API-driven health checks and automated routing so traffic is directed to the most appropriate datacenter and issues are bypassed without user impact. The switch delivered immediate insight into routing decisions, eliminated suboptimal routes, improved performance and reliability, reduced manual work, and preserved the company’s seamless user experience.
